Я только что обновил до Бионического Бобра (18.04) от Гостеприимного и после плескания в GNOME3, я решил вернуться к Единице (я предпочитаю иметь индикаторы приложения и HUD). Моя раскладка клавиатуры установлена на US International с мертвыми клавишами, и я также установил fcitx с Простой Поддержкой Системы транслитерации китайских иероглифов, таким образом, я мог ввести китайский язык.
Я заметил что начиная с обновления, индикатора языка en
появляется рядом со значком клавиатуры, в то время как я нахожусь в текстовом поле и на американской раскладке клавиатуры. Это делает значки в переходе лотка левыми и правыми. Действительно ли возможно просто сохранить значок клавиатуры и заставить индикатор языка уйти?
Я вошел в систему сессии Единицы, включил Fcitx и могу подтвердить поведение. При использовании метода ввода Fcitx (в моем случае Sunpinyin) я вижу это:
и при использовании английской (американской) раскладки клавиатуры я вижу это:
когда во входной области, или иначе us
часть исчезает.
Я предполагаю, что объяснение состоит в том, что там существуют значки для методов ввода Fcitx, но не для раскладок клавиатуры XKB, и затем это показывает универсальный значок Fcitx вместо этого вместе (иногда) с сокращением. Если я вспоминаю это правильно, это было похоже на это некоторое время, т.е. это не является новым в 18,04.
Если Вам не нравится то поведение, одна опция состоит в том, чтобы переключиться на IBus, установку, например. ibus-libpinyin
, перевход в систему, и выбирает Интеллектуальную Систему транслитерации китайских иероглифов во Вводе текста.